A general account of hydatid disease is given in the form of questions and answers. The questions were asked of a veterinarian by the parents of a 9-year-old boy from Kentucky, USA. He had become infected with Echinococcus granulosus during a 3-month visit to Italy. The child underwent 2 surgical procedures to remove a 4 cm cyst of the lung and a 5 cm cyst in his liver, and was well at 6 months follow-up.
